He’s 28, three years older than me. He’s always been an irresponsible, selfish, thoughtless bloke.
He misbehaved at school, treated my parents with total contempt and got in trouble with the police.
He seemed to enjoy hurting everyone. I thought he’d end up in jail but he now works in sales and earns way more than me.
He’s got a beautiful girlfriend as well but he’s still his usual cocky, unpleasant self.
I’m a hard-working guy and I’ve tried to do the right thing. I went to university like my parents wanted me to but I’m still struggling to find a good job. I can’t even afford to leave home.
My feelings of bitterness towards my big brother are eating me up.
DEIDRE SAYS: I do understand your dismay that life seems so unfair but try to be glad that your parents aren’t stressed about him like they so often must have been in the past.
It’s your life that counts so don’t waste your energy comparing yourself with your brother.
Job satisfaction matters more than money.
Focus on finding a job that you love and looking at ways to make your life more fulfilling outside of work.
